What the white card is, and who requires it

The white card is the usual name for the building and construction induction card provided after you finish the device of proficiency CPCWHS1001 Prepare to work securely in the building and construction sector with a signed up training organisation. It replaced various state-based cards years back and is nationally recognised under the harmonised job health and wellness framework.

image

Anyone who will execute construction job requires a white card. That includes pupils, profession aides, plant operators, carpenters, concreters, roofers, sparkies, plumbing technicians, painters, labourers, site designers, project supervisors, land surveyors, and also some delivery chauffeurs and cleansers when they regularly enter and work on energetic building and construction sites. If you are not sure whether your function counts as building job, consider what you do on website. If your tasks bring you right into the construction area where dangers like falls, mobile plant, power tools, excavation, or interim electrical supply exist, you ought to anticipate to be requested your card.

The white card is issued once, then continues to be valid unless you stop working in construction for 2 or more years. If you run out the industry for that long, you will likely be called for to finish the training once more prior to you return.

How white card training in Brisbane generally runs

A Brisbane white card course typically takes 6 to 8 hours in a solitary day. Many companies supply weekday sessions, some add Saturday choices, and a few run late-start classes to fit change workers. You will certainly sit in a small group setting, typically 8 to 20 individuals. The trainer covers security law, tasks of PCBUs and workers, hazard recognition, danger control using the pecking order of controls, common site risks, and incident feedback. Expect interactive conversation Click here and a few short video clips. Reliable trainers lean on actual task examples, not simply slides.

Assessment has two components. Initially, a knowledge component, frequently a created or on the internet test you total during class. Second, a practical demo. In Brisbane, that typically entails putting on basic PPE appropriately, reading and discussing straightforward SWMS or site signage, and going through how you would certainly recognize and manage threats in sample circumstances. You do not need market experience to pass, yet you do require to involve, ask questions, and follow instructions.

On successful completion, the RTO problems a Statement of Accomplishment for CPCWHS1001. In Queensland, a physical white card is after that released. Durations differ, however several trainees receive a temporary evidence of completion on the day and the card by article within 1 to 3 weeks. Ask the provider just how they deal with acting evidence, since some sites will approve the Declaration of Accomplishment while the card remains in the mail, and others insist on seeing the physical card.

ID, USI, and eligibility checks

RTOs must confirm your identity. Queensland carriers generally need one primary photo ID, like a chauffeur permit or ticket, and sometimes a second document. If your lawful name has transformed, bring evidence. You likewise require a USI, which is a cost-free, government-issued education number that keeps your training background in one area. Create it online in 10 minutes. Bring the exact information to course, or you run the risk of hold-ups releasing your Statement of Attainment.

Language, proficiency, and numeracy checks belong to enrolment. Do not be put off. If you can check out site signage and follow fundamental composed guidelines, you will certainly be fine. If you have learning demands, inform the supplier beforehand. Additional time and alternative assessment methods are commonly offered within the rules.

Will an interstate online white card be approved in Brisbane

In general, white cards are nationally identified. If you finished genuine construction induction training with an RTO in one more state or territory, your card must be accepted on Brisbane sites. That claimed, site managers have a duty to make certain skills, and some will certainly scrutinise totally self-paced on-line cards a lot more very closely. A couple of primary service providers in South East Queensland instruct subcontractors to send out employees with classroom or live-supervised cards just. It is not about the colour of the card, it has to do with how the knowing and evaluation were provided. If you currently hold an interstate white card from a reputable service provider, you ought to be fine. If you will sign up and you stay in Brisbane, picking a Queensland-focused provider makes acceptance easier.

What employers and website supervisors look for

From a manager's chair, a white card is a standard, not a ticket to carry out risky work. The website will certainly still induct you. You will certainly still require task-specific tickets, like a high danger work permit for EWP or a VOC for a specific piece of plant. What managers examine the first day is whether you can adhere to the essentials you discovered in white card training under genuine stress. That means wearing PPE correctly without going after tips, checking out the SWMS before you sign it, quiting working when conditions transform, and speaking out early if something looks wrong. Workers that treat the white card as a living baseline make trust fund quickly.
